Title:
SEPARATION OF ACIDIC OIL AND BASIC OIL IN LIQUEFIED COAL OIL

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To separate and fractionate the acidic oil and basic oil in liquefied coal oil, remarkably improving the separation selectivity of each component existing in these oils, by dissolving and extracting the acidic oil and basic oil respectively with dilute aqueous solution of an alkali and dilute aqueous solution of an acid.

CONSTITUTION: The acidic oil and the basic oil in the liquefied coal oil are dissolved and extracted respectively with an aqueous solution of alkali and an aqueous solution of acid each having a concentration of ≤0.2N. Various components in the acidic oil and the basic oil are separated successively in the order of the component having lower molecular weight, smaller substitution degree of alkyl, and shorter side chain.

EFFECT: Phenol, cresol, etc. in acidic oil and pyridine, etc. in basic oil can be separated economically.
